What companies run services between Doncaster, England and Wincanton, England?

You can take a train from Doncaster to Wincanton via London Kings Cross, King's Cross St. Pancras station, Paddington, London Paddington, and Castle Cary in around 4h 36m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Doncaster Frenchgate Interchange/C7 to Memorial Hall via London Victoria Coach Station Arrivals, Victoria Coach Station, and Hammersmith Bus Station in around 8h 34m.
